<a id="a7d8b24e46a691bea139d347bc6102a9a"></a>
<h2 class="memtitle"><span class="permalink"><a href="#a7d8b24e46a691bea139d347bc6102a9a">&#9670;&nbsp;</a></span>anonymous enum</h2>

<div class="memitem">
<div class="memproto">
      <table class="memname">
        <tr>
          <td class="memname">anonymous enum</td>
        </tr>
      </table>
</div><div class="memdoc">
<table class="fieldtable">
<tr><th colspan="2">Enumerator</th></tr><tr><td class="fieldname"><a id="a7d8b24e46a691bea139d347bc6102a9aa4e374000be4ce7c0f319e335b008c19a"></a>WILDCARD_LIMIT_ERROR&#160;</td><td class="fielddoc"><p>Throw an error if OP_WILDCARD exceeds its expansion limit. </p>
<pre class="fragment">    Xapian::WildcardError will be thrown when the query is actually
    run.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7d8b24e46a691bea139d347bc6102a9aaa08d373f6c100bdbff9420dc51a621f2"></a>WILDCARD_LIMIT_FIRST&#160;</td><td class="fielddoc"><p>Stop expanding when OP_WILDCARD reaches its expansion limit. </p>
<pre class="fragment">    This makes the wildcard expand to only the first N terms (sorted
    by byte order).
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7d8b24e46a691bea139d347bc6102a9aaa1568bc15280d8c8a10128d3b7f1db71"></a>WILDCARD_LIMIT_MOST_FREQUENT&#160;</td><td class="fielddoc"><p>Limit OP_WILDCARD expansion to the most frequent terms. </p>
<pre class="fragment">    If OP_WILDCARD would expand to more than its expansion limit, the
    most frequent terms are taken.  This approach works well for cases
    such as expanding a partial term at the end of a query string which
    the user hasn't finished typing yet - as well as being less expense
    to evaluate than the full expansion, using only the most frequent
    terms tends to give better results too.
</pre> </td></tr>
</table>

<h2 class="memtitle"><span class="permalink"><a href="#a7e7b6b8ad0c915c2364578dfaaf6100b">&#9670;&nbsp;</a></span>op</h2>

<div class="memitem">
<div class="memproto">
      <table class="memname">
        <tr>
          <td class="memname">enum <a class="el" href="classXapian_1_1Query.html#a7e7b6b8ad0c915c2364578dfaaf6100b">Xapian::Query::op</a></td>
        </tr>
      </table>
</div><div class="memdoc">

<p><a class="el" href="classXapian_1_1Query.html" title="Class representing a query.">Query</a> operators. </p>
<table class="fieldtable">
<tr><th colspan="2">Enumerator</th></tr><t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100bab99aad2dfc85eccc56163bc65eb0fdda"></a>OP_AND&#160;</td><td class="fielddoc"><p>Match only documents which all subqueries match. </p>
<pre class="fragment">    When used in a weighted context, the weight is the sum of the
    weights for all the subqueries.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100bac50e54f3dd9dc59dab7daa2c50cf631b"></a>OP_OR&#160;</td><td class="fielddoc"><p>Match documents which at least one subquery matches. </p>
<pre class="fragment">    When used in a weighted context, the weight is the sum of the
    weights for matching subqueries (so additional matching subqueries
    will mean a higher weight).
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100bada56688a72af48cc1cee70a5b36f2a94"></a>OP_AND_NOT&#160;</td><td class="fielddoc"><p>Match documents which the first subquery matches but no others do. </p>
<pre class="fragment">    When used in a weighted context, the weight is just the weight of
    the first subquery.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ba3f186e28a8cc2a5c4cb99745dda5cedf"></a>OP_XOR&#160;</td><td class="fielddoc"><p>Match documents which an odd number of subqueries match. </p>
<pre class="fragment">    When used in a weighted context, the weight is the sum of the
    weights for matching subqueries (so additional matching subqueries
    will mean a higher weight).
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ba5990dfefc0a0a63861630b743f507356"></a>OP_AND_MAYBE&#160;</td><td class="fielddoc"><p>Match the first subquery taking extra weight from other subqueries. </p>
<pre class="fragment">    When used in a weighted context, the weight is the sum of the
    weights for matching subqueries (so additional matching subqueries
    will mean a higher weight).

    Because only the first subquery determines which documents are
    matched, in a non-weighted context only the first subquery matters.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100bac657f344bf26128ab7bf8fe25410b102"></a>OP_FILTER&#160;</td><td class="fielddoc"><p>Match like OP_AND but only taking weight from the first subquery. </p>
<pre class="fragment">    When used in a non-weighted context, OP_FILTER and OP_AND are
    equivalent.

    In older 1.4.x, the third and subsequent subqueries were ignored
    in some situations.  This was fixed in 1.4.15.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ba7a78c8353d5d06d3a38c1899ae762b21"></a>OP_NEAR&#160;</td><td class="fielddoc"><p>Match only documents where all subqueries match near each other. </p>
<pre class="fragment">    The subqueries must match at term positions within the specified
    window size, in any order.

    Currently subqueries must be terms or terms composed with OP_OR.

    When used in a weighted context, the weight is the sum of the
    weights for all the subqueries.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100bace19bf1e7b2d8aa393aabdd061a0866e"></a>OP_PHRASE&#160;</td><td class="fielddoc"><p>Match only documents where all subqueries match near and in order. </p>
<pre class="fragment">    The subqueries must match at term positions within the specified
    window size, in the same term position order as subquery order.

    Currently subqueries must be terms or terms composed with OP_OR.

    When used in a weighted context, the weight is the sum of the
    weights for all the subqueries.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ba25ad30ce2b6661570ffacd8f910b6d34"></a>OP_VALUE_RANGE&#160;</td><td class="fielddoc"><p>Match only documents where a value slot is within a given range. </p>
<pre class="fragment">    This operator never contributes weight.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ba0fecaeeb3caa94b1a578fd7953cc60ee"></a>OP_SCALE_WEIGHT&#160;</td><td class="fielddoc"><p>Scale the weight contributed by a subquery. </p>
<pre class="fragment">    The weight is the weight of the subquery multiplied by the
    specified non-negative scale factor (so if the scale factor is
    zero then the subquery contributes no weight).
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ba9a010fd66a56d9242d6dfae2bae0850b"></a>OP_ELITE_SET&#160;</td><td class="fielddoc"><p>Pick the best N subqueries and combine with OP_OR. </p>
<pre class="fragment">    If you want to implement a feature which finds documents similar to
    a piece of text, an obvious approach is to build an "OR" query from
    all the terms in the text, and run this query against a database
    containing the documents.  However such a query can contain a lots
    of terms and be quite slow to perform, yet many of these terms
    don't contribute usefully to the results.

    The OP_ELITE_SET operator can be used instead of OP_OR in this
    situation.  OP_ELITE_SET selects the most important ''N'' terms and
    then acts as an OP_OR query with just these, ignoring any other
    terms.  This will usually return results just as good as the full
    OP_OR query, but much faster.

    In general, the OP_ELITE_SET operator can be used when you have a
    large OR query, but it doesn't matter if the search completely
    ignores some of the less important terms in the query.

    The subqueries don't have to be terms, but if they aren't then
    OP_ELITE_SET will look at the estimated frequencies of the
    subqueries and so could pick a subset which don't actually
    match any documents even if the full OR would match some.

    You can specify a parameter to the query constructor which control
    the number of terms which OP_ELITE_SET will pick.  If not
    specified, this defaults to 10 (Xapian used to default to
    &lt;code&gt;ceil(sqrt(number_of_subqueries))&lt;/code&gt; if there are more
    than 100 subqueries, but this rather arbitrary special case was
    dropped in 1.3.0).  For example, this will pick the best 7 terms:

    &lt;pre&gt;
    Xapian::Query query(Xapian::Query::OP_ELITE_SET, subqs.begin(), subqs.end(), 7);
    &lt;/pre&gt;

   If the number of subqueries is less than this threshold,
   OP_ELITE_SET behaves identically to OP_OR.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100baf914b109cfe787be77e7c92c99626f01"></a>OP_VALUE_GE&#160;</td><td class="fielddoc"><p>Match only documents where a value slot is &gt;= a given value. </p>
<pre class="fragment">    Similar to @a OP_VALUE_RANGE, but open-ended.

    This operator never contributes weight.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100bad6cede66b463ceb5f689979e1b6a8a55"></a>OP_VALUE_LE&#160;</td><td class="fielddoc"><p>Match only documents where a value slot is &lt;= a given value. </p>
<pre class="fragment">    Similar to @a OP_VALUE_RANGE, but open-ended.

    This operator never contributes weight.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100bad8456bafb560c984aff9b4d90a00d36e"></a>OP_SYNONYM&#160;</td><td class="fielddoc"><p>Match like OP_OR but weighting as if a single term. </p>
<pre class="fragment">    The weight is calculated combining the statistics for the
    subqueries to approximate the weight of a single term occurring
    with those statistics.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ba21a0e2b8033848ec21a6cd025bfd2ccb"></a>OP_MAX&#160;</td><td class="fielddoc"><p>Pick the maximum weight of any subquery. </p>
<pre class="fragment">    Matches the same documents as @a OP_OR, but the weight contributed
    is the maximum weight from any matching subquery (for OP_OR, it's
    the sum of the weights from the matching subqueries).

    Added in Xapian 1.3.2.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ba2c7eed8ccb36f70d9e4432be27acf83e"></a>OP_WILDCARD&#160;</td><td class="fielddoc"><p>Wildcard expansion. </p>
<pre class="fragment">    Added in Xapian 1.3.3.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100baf93bdb686fea46eb2dae4c36a52e0e3c"></a>OP_INVALID&#160;</td><td class="fielddoc"><p>Construct an invalid query. </p>
<pre class="fragment">    This can be useful as a placeholder - for example @a RangeProcessor
    uses it as a return value to indicate that a range hasn't been
    recognised.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100baf2af9022b2b87022860571dd93ae08bf"></a>LEAF_TERM&#160;</td><td class="fielddoc"><p>Value returned by <a class="el" href="classXapian_1_1Query.html#a16b24d0b964fd7cf65148490b0b77d39" title="Get the type of the top level of the query.">get_type()</a> for a term. </p>
</td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ba1f6abfe9fe662dc944080f0c1a3be7f8"></a>LEAF_POSTING_SOURCE&#160;</td><td class="fielddoc"><p>Value returned by <a class="el" href="classXapian_1_1Query.html#a16b24d0b964fd7cf65148490b0b77d39" title="Get the type of the top level of the query.">get_type()</a> for a <a class="el" href="classXapian_1_1PostingSource.html" title="Base class which provides an &quot;external&quot; source of postings.">PostingSource</a>. </p>
</td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100ba6ea40adb27db3ef49a43d748b475a80b"></a>LEAF_MATCH_ALL&#160;</td><td class="fielddoc"><p>Value returned by <a class="el" href="classXapian_1_1Query.html#a16b24d0b964fd7cf65148490b0b77d39" title="Get the type of the top level of the query.">get_type()</a> for MatchAll or equivalent. </p>
<pre class="fragment">    This is returned for any &lt;code&gt;Xapian::Query(std::string())&lt;/code&gt;
    object.
</pre> </td></tr>
<tr><td class="fieldname"><a id="a7e7b6b8ad0c915c2364578dfaaf6100babb387c566d074cc1f7fe2bb68d7e282a"></a>LEAF_MATCH_NOTHING&#160;</td><td class="fielddoc"><p>Value returned by <a class="el" href="classXapian_1_1Query.html#a16b24d0b964fd7cf65148490b0b77d39" title="Get the type of the top level of the query.">get_type()</a> for MatchNothing or equivalent. </p>
<pre class="fragment">    This is returned for any &lt;code&gt;Xapian::Query()&lt;/code&gt; object.
</pre> </td></tr>
</table>

<h2 class="groupheader">Member Data Documentation</h2>
<a id="a9e30b80314359e5ddd7ca4ffa84b6edd"></a>
<h2 class="memtitle"><span class="permalink"><a href="#a9e30b80314359e5ddd7ca4ffa84b6edd">&#9670;&nbsp;</a></span>MatchAll</h2>

<div class="memitem">
<div class="memproto">
<table class="mlabels">
  <tr>
  <td class="mlabels-left">
      <table class="memname">
        <tr>
          <td class="memname">const <a class="el" href="classXapian_1_1Query.html">Xapian::Query</a> Xapian::Query::MatchAll</td>
        </tr>
      </table>
  </td>
  <td class="mlabels-right">
<span class="mlabels"><span class="mlabel">static</span></span>  </td>
  </tr>
</table>
</div><div class="memdoc">

<p>A query matching all documents. </p>
<p>This is a static instance of <code><a class="el" href="classXapian_1_1Query.html" title="Class representing a query.">Xapian::Query(std::string())</a></code>. If you are constructing <a class="el" href="classXapian_1_1Query.html" title="Class representing a query.">Query</a> objects which use <em>MatchAll</em> in different threads then the reference counting of the static object can get messed up by concurrent access so you should instead use <code><a class="el" href="classXapian_1_1Query.html" title="Class representing a query.">Xapian::Query(std::string())</a></code> directly. </p>

</div>
</div>
<a id="a5d2584f441d85a126004699479df0350"></a>
<h2 class="memtitle"><span class="permalink"><a href="#a5d2584f441d85a126004699479df0350">&#9670;&nbsp;</a></span>MatchNothing</h2>

<div class="memitem">
<div class="memproto">
<table class="mlabels">
  <tr>
  <td class="mlabels-left">
      <table class="memname">
        <tr>
          <td class="memname">const <a class="el" href="classXapian_1_1Query.html">Xapian::Query</a> Xapian::Query::MatchNothing</td>
        </tr>
      </table>
  </td>
  <td class="mlabels-right">
<span class="mlabels"><span class="mlabel">static</span></span>  </td>
  </tr>
</table>
</div><div class="memdoc">

<p>A query matching no documents. </p>
<p>This is a static instance of a default-constructed <a class="el" href="classXapian_1_1Query.html" title="Class representing a query.">Xapian::Query</a> object. It is safe to use concurrently from different threads, unlike <em>MatchAll</em> (this is because MatchNothing has a NULL internal object so there's no reference counting happening).</p>
<p>When combined with other <a class="el" href="classXapian_1_1Query.html" title="Class representing a query.">Query</a> objects using the various supported operators, MatchNothing works like <code>false</code> in boolean logic, so <code>MatchNothing &amp; q</code> is <code>MatchNothing</code>, while <code>MatchNothing | q</code> is <code>q</code>. </p>

</div>
</div>
